  • Patent number: 7944672
    Abstract: A control device applicable to an actuator and including a voltage detection unit and a limit switch control unit. The control device is inbuilt inside the actuator without any additional control circuit for the control of the limit switches and the detection of the input voltage range. The limit switches are used to limit the travel of an actuating member of the actuator so as to avoid collision of the mechanism. The voltage detection unit serves to detect the input voltage range to control the operation of the actuator. Accordingly, the mechanism or the motor is protected from damage due to excessively low or high input voltage. The limit switches are freely adjustable in position and protected from high current. Therefore, the contacts of the limit switches are not liable to damage and the lifetime of the limit switches is prolonged. The control device further has electronic brake effect.

  • Patent number: 7550940
    Abstract: An overload current control circuit for a DC motor comprises: a DC motor, a DC power source, a power semiconductor assembly, and a sampling resistor that are connected in series. The overload current control circuit further comprises a voltage polarity switching circuit that is connected to a circuit between the sampling resistor and the overload protection and detection circuit to control the single polarity of the sampling voltage of the first and second terminals of the sampling resistor, so as to provide constant voltage potential to the overload protection and detection circuit, thus providing overload protection to the DC motor.

  • Publication number: 20090021193
    Abstract: A DC motor with a rotation direction switching circuit comprises a second power semiconductor assembly and a first power semiconductor assembly which are switched on and off alternatively by changing the polarity of the DC power source, thus providing an electronic rotation direction switching method. The service life is prolonged and the replacement times relatively reduce, and as a result, the material cost and maintenance cost of the rotation direction switching circuit is reduced. Therefore, it can improve the willingness of the user to use the DC motor with the rotation direction switching circuit and relatively improve the economic value of the DC motor.
